Career path

Career Role Description
Dairy Farm Ecosystem Specialist Develop and implement sustainable practices for dairy farms, optimizing milk production while minimizing environmental impact. Focus on improving water and energy efficiency, waste management, and carbon footprint reduction.
Precision Dairy Farming Technician (Precision Agriculture) Utilize technology for data-driven decision-making in dairy farming. This includes sensor technology, data analysis, and precision livestock farming techniques to enhance efficiency and animal welfare.
Dairy Farm Sustainability Consultant Advise dairy farmers on sustainable practices, implementing environmental management systems, and achieving certification standards. Support farms in reducing their ecological footprint and improving overall sustainability.
Dairy Nutrition Specialist (Ruminant Nutrition) Develop and manage feeding programs for dairy cows, optimizing nutrition for milk yield, reproductive performance, and animal health. Focus on sustainable feed sourcing and minimizing environmental impact of feed production.
